Title: trm freestyle what brakes were original!!!!
Post by: sideshowbob on July 26, 2015, 11:06 PM
Hi can anyone help trm freestyle I'm on a rebuild what are the original brakes for the bike it was 30 year's ago since I rode this bike and I swoped bits from all other bikes ie mongoose and dimond back . Thanks sideshowbob.
Title: Re: trm freestyle what brakes were original!!!!
Post by: region11 on July 27, 2015, 01:31 PM
Most popular brakes for this era would have been Dia-Compe MX1000 or 900's.  Or a copy of the said brakes :)
Title: Re: trm freestyle what brakes were original!!!!
Post by: glenboy on July 27, 2015, 02:18 PM
As above these only came as framesets not complete bikes so the brakes which were put on was what was about around 1984 so mx1000/mx900 as said above copies of these were used a lot bitd,
Title: Re: trm freestyle what brakes were original!!!!
Post by: Andy1970 on July 27, 2015, 06:13 PM
MX 1000s are what you need.900s,901s or 880s dont really have enough reach.
Title: Re: trm freestyle what brakes were original!!!!
Post by: brettypeeps on July 27, 2015, 06:33 PM
MX 1000s are the preferred choice but 880/901s will work
